After the winter solstice, it would be less than a month before the end of the year.

Even if the Jiang Family had been through too many upheavals in the past six months, even resulting in the loss of life, and the careers of Jiang Yuanbai and his brothers weren’t going smoothly, and the outside world still saw the Jiang Family as a joke to talk about over tea, the New Year still had to be celebrated.

Everyone in the Mansion was unknowingly starting to get busy. Night Wind Hall’s Zhenzhu and Feicui had come several times, asking when Jiang Li planned to go to the jewelry store to pick out jewelry. Jiang Li didn’t have a particular fondness for jewelry, and after going once, she didn’t want to go again. Madam Jiang the Elder then had tailors come to Fangfei Garden to tailor new clothes for Jiang Li, knowing that it was a way to make amends to her.

Speaking of tailoring clothes, there was also an occasion when Madam Jiang the Elder took her to attend a banquet, a homestyle feast of an official’s family. Jiang Li wore a dress made of the Wave Pattern fabric newly released by the Ye Family, which immediately caught the attention of the various noble ladies and wives, all of whom pulled at her, asking where to buy the fabric. Jiang Li took the opportunity to mention the name of the Ye Family of Xiangyang, and soon after, Ye Mingyu received a letter from Xiangyang stating that the Ye Family’s Wave Pattern fabric was now in high demand, and many clothing stores in Yanjing City were placing orders for it. The Ye Family’s textile factory had been rushing to work almost day and night.

When she heard Ye Mingyu talk about this, Jiang Li felt a sense of relief. Fortunately, the Ye Family’s Ancient Fragrance Satin hadn’t declined and they had the rising success of the Wave Pattern fabric; it seemed the Ye Family’s tough times were over. Old Madam Ye’s health was also gradually improving, and everything was developing for the better. Even Xue Huaiyuan had become more spirited day by day under Situ Jiuyue’s care, and was now able to recognize and call out people’s names.

This end-of-year season didn’t seem too difficult to endure, as it looked like many issues could be easily resolved without any real predicament.

Fifteen days after the winter solstice, Hai Tang returned.

Zhao Ke stood in front of Jiang Li’s window and said, "She’s now in the Duke Residence. She would draw too much attention at the Jiang Family’s place, and there are people watching the Ye Family’s door. Miss Jiang the Second wants to meet Hai Tang, and the sir has said that you can go to the Duke Residence."

Jiang Li, "...I’m afraid that will attract attention."

"No matter, the sir has said that if Miss Jiang the Second wishes to go, she can go before the late night, and no one will notice," Zhao Ke said simply, giving Jiang Li quite a headache.

"How do I leave the house in the dead of night?" Jiang Li asked, hoping the person in front of her would consider some practical issues. She was a young lady from the Grand Secretary’s Family, how could she leave in the middle of the night, especially to go to the Duke Residence. If only she had Qinggong skills like Ye Mingyu, and could go incognito with no fixed tracks, that would be ideal.

"Don’t worry, Miss Second, I will arrange everything," Zhao Ke confidently assured.

Jiang Li studied Zhao Ke for a good while, to the point where Zhao Ke began to feel somewhat ashamed and lowered his head, before she was convinced that the guard in front of her was serious about offering such a solution. She still wanted to resist a bit and asked, "Isn’t there another way? We can actually meet in a tavern on the street."

"The person Miss Jiang the Second is seeking doesn’t trust others very much, and even up to now, is still on guard against us," Zhao Ke replied. "If we hadn’t subdued her, she would have run away."

"You subdued her?" Jiang Li was shocked. "Did you not tell her that the person looking for her wasn’t going to hurt her, that they were there to help her?"

"We told her," Zhao Ke shrugged, "but she didn’t believe us."

Jiang Li’s heart sank little by little. Hai Tang was so wary of others, unwilling to trust anyone, which indicated that she must have really faced some troubles, or at least encountered something, to be so on guard. At this point, Jiang Li could not afford to care about anything else; the pressing matter was to meet Hai Tang, reassure her, and clarify what had happened after her supposed death and after she and Du Juan had fled.

Jiang Li said, "Alright, I will go to the Duke Residence tonight. I wonder if the Duke would find it convenient?"

Zhao Ke looked up in surprise. Was she agreeing so quickly? He had thought that Miss Jiang the Second would struggle for a while before consenting, considering a young lady visiting a strange man’s mansion, and in the dead of night at that. Anyone would hesitate. But then again, he realized it wasn’t quite the same, after all, the sir was Duke Su, the admired figure of all of Northern Yan. Even if something truly happened, which was highly unlikely, Miss Jiang the Second would not be at a loss, and might even come out ahead.

Thinking this way, the surprise in Zhao Ke’s eyes quickly dissipated, replaced by a look of understanding as he said, "Good, I will report back to the sir immediately."

Jiang Li nodded.
